Erasmus partic- ularly was noted for his wit and for his ability to turn aside any serious discussions that might arise among his friends, so as to prevent any- thing like unpleasant argument in their friendly intercourse. A favorite way seems to have been to insist on telling one of the old jokes from a classic author whose origin would naturally be presumed to be much later than the date the New Learning had found for it.
